Maker Change

Maker Change is a community activation project turning urban disconnection from nature into places for connection and action. We make open-source tree sculptures from reclaimed and bio-based materials, with QR-coded leaves that link to free action cards - small challenges like planting a seed bomb or taking a listening walk.

The trees are built locally with recycled or biocomposite materials, and residents co-create the action cards, so each one fits its own neighbourhood. Ideas feed back into a shared open-source repository, and anyone can build their own tree using our free guide.

We are collaborating with woody.bio on an accessible, low-impact bio-composite wood for digital fabrication, and we are now entering our co-design and prototyping phase.
